  • Separated from someone you love: mother, father, sister, brother, wife, husband, child, friend, pet
  • Separated from a career you love
  • Separated from a home you love
  • Separated from the life you thought would continue on the road you were traveling

Grief is the sorrow and suffering that must be walked THROUGH by everyone who has experienced a loss. The walk is characterized by:

  • Alone-ness. No one can do it for you.
  • Timelessness. There are no shortcuts and detours may occur.
  • Darkness. Each path is unique to the person. There is only One who sees in the dark just as He does in the light (Psalm 139).
"God gives us simple directions as we walk through the valley of grief. As He told David in Psalm 23, it was His intention that we walk through the valley, not get stuck. Walking my own roads after the death of my son, my parents, and my first marriage, I can say now that each road was different; each one had some very difficult periods and yet God was faithful. It is my prayer as I write this book that others will also receive God's healing, life-giving words."
